The "Permanent Record" Trap

In the modern job market, the line between "off the clock" and "on the clock" has largely evaporated. While your grandfather might have left his work at the factory gates, your career now follows you home in your pocket. Today, isn’t just a digital scrapbook; it’s an unofficial, 24/7 performance review that can either catapult your career or quietly dismantle it.
